The Black Effect Podcast Festival: Celebrating Black Voices in Audio

A Platform for Amplification: The Black Effect’s Mission

The air crackled with palpable energy. Thousands, united by a shared love for storytelling and a thirst for authentic connection, gathered for the Black Effect Podcast Festival. More than just a conference, it was a vibrant celebration of Black creativity, innovation, and the undeniable power of audio to shape narratives and build communities. In a media landscape often criticized for its lack of diversity, the Black Effect Podcast Network, spearheaded by the visionary Charlamagne Tha God, has emerged as a vital force, providing a much-needed platform for Black voices to be heard, amplified, and celebrated. This festival wasn’t just an event; it was a testament to the transformative impact of giving space and resources to creators who have historically been marginalized. The Black Effect Podcast Festival serves as a powerful incubator for Black talent, fostering community bonds, and influencing the trajectory of the entire podcasting industry. This article delves into the heart of the festival, exploring its purpose, highlights, impact, and the crucial role it plays in reshaping the soundscape of audio storytelling.

Experiencing the Festival: Content and Connections

The Black Effect Podcast Festival is renowned for its impressive lineup of featured podcasters, each bringing their unique voice and perspective to the stage. These aren’t just individuals with microphones; they are cultural commentators, thought leaders, and storytellers who are shaping the conversations of our time. Attendees can expect to see a diverse range of talent, from established podcasting veterans to rising stars who are quickly making a name for themselves. Many podcasters who participate in the Black Effect Podcast Festival are well-known for creating content that explores complex issues with nuance and insight. The festival gives attendees a chance to hear firsthand from these talented creators and to gain a deeper understanding of their work.

The festival also offers a wide array of engaging sessions, thought-provoking panels, and hands-on workshops designed to empower attendees with the knowledge and skills they need to succeed in the podcasting industry. These sessions cover a wide range of topics, from the basics of podcasting production to advanced marketing strategies. Attendees can learn from industry experts, network with fellow creators, and gain valuable insights into the latest trends and technologies. These learning experiences focus on equipping attendees with the tools and knowledge they need to pursue their podcasting aspirations. Special guest speakers from across the entertainment industry often participate in these workshops, providing additional expertise and insights.
